Understanding the Importance of Attic Ventilation
Why Ventilation Matters
Attic ventilation serves two primary purposes: regulating temperature and controlling moisture levels. During the summer months, a poorly ventilated attic can trap heat, making your air conditioning system work harder and driving up energy costs. Conversely, in winter, inadequate ventilation can lead to ice dam formation, which can cause significant damage to your roof and gutters.
Consequences of Poor Ventilation
Without proper ventilation, you may encounter several issues:
- Mold Growth: Excess moisture can lead to mold, which poses health risks and can damage your home’s structure.
- Roof Damage: Ice dams can form when warm air from the attic melts snow on the roof, leading to water infiltration.
- Energy Inefficiency: Increased energy bills due to overworked heating and cooling systems can strain your budget.
Components of an Effective Attic Ventilation System
Intake and Exhaust Vents
To create an effective ventilation system, you need both intake and exhaust vents. Intake vents allow fresh air to enter the attic, while exhaust vents enable hot, stale air to escape. This continuous airflow helps maintain a balanced temperature and moisture level.
- Intake Vents: Typically located at the eaves or soffits, these vents draw in cooler air from outside.
- Exhaust Vents: Positioned at or near the roof’s peak, these vents allow hot air to escape.
Types of Vents
- Soffit Vents: Located under the eaves, these vents are essential for drawing in fresh air. They should never be blocked by insulation.
- Ridge Vents: Running along the peak of the roof, ridge vents provide a continuous exhaust outlet for hot air.
- Gable Vents: Installed on the exterior walls, these vents can serve as both intake and exhaust options, depending on wind direction.
- Static Vents: These passive vents allow air to flow freely without mechanical assistance.
- Powered Vents: These electrically powered options actively pull hot air out of the attic, but they require proper intake for optimal performance.
Assessing Your Current Ventilation Setup
Evaluating Airflow
Before making any changes, assess your current ventilation system. A simple way to do this is by observing the airflow through your attic. You can use a smoke pencil or incense stick to visualize air movement. If the smoke doesn’t disperse evenly, you may have stagnant areas that need attention.
Identifying Blockages
Check for blockages in both intake and exhaust vents. Over time, debris, insulation, or even pests can obstruct airflow. Ensure that all vents are clear and functioning properly.
Enhancing Your Attic Ventilation
Calculating Ventilation Needs
A good rule of thumb is to have one square foot of ventilation for every 150 square feet of attic space. This ratio can vary based on local building codes and specific conditions, so it’s wise to consult with a professional if you’re unsure.
Installation of Rafter Vents
If you are insulating your attic, consider installing rafter vents. These vents create a channel for air to flow from the soffit vents to the ridge vents, ensuring that insulation does not block airflow.

Seasonal Considerations for Attic Ventilation
Summer Ventilation Tips
During the hot summer months, it’s crucial to maximize ventilation to keep your attic cool. Here are some tips:
- Utilize Ridge Vents: Ensure that ridge vents are clear and functioning properly to allow hot air to escape.
- Consider Powered Vents: If your attic tends to get excessively hot, installing powered vents can help remove heat more efficiently.
Winter Ventilation Tips
In winter, maintaining a cool attic is essential to prevent ice dams. Here’s how to manage your ventilation:
- Keep Vents Open: Contrary to popular belief, do not block vents in winter. Allowing cold air in helps keep the attic cool and prevents snow from melting and refreezing.
- Check Insulation: Ensure insulation is adequately installed to prevent warm air from rising into the attic.
Common Mistakes to Avoid
Improper Vent Placement
One of the most common mistakes homeowners make is placing intake vents too high or exhaust vents too low. This can disrupt airflow and reduce the effectiveness of the ventilation system. Always ensure that intake vents are at the lowest point and exhaust vents at the highest point.
Blocking Airflow with Insulation
When insulating your attic, avoid covering intake vents with insulation. This can severely limit airflow and negate the benefits of your ventilation system.
